Pindaré-Mirim weather in December

In December, Pindaré-Mirim sees average daytime highs of 33°C and overnight lows near 25°C, with 108 mm of rain across 14.6 wet days and about 12.2 hours of daylight. It is the 4th-warmest and 6th-wettest month of the year here.

Day-to-day highs hold fairly steady near 33°C through the month. The sky is clear or mostly clear about 17% of the time in December, and the air most often feels oppressive.

Daylight stretches from about 12 h 12 min at the start of December to 12 h 12 min by month's end. Set against the rest of the year, December is Pindaré-Mirim's 7th-clearest and 5th-windiest month. For the whole year in context, see Pindaré-Mirim's year-round climate.

Temperature in December

Average highAverage lowShaded bands: 10–90% of days

Day-to-day highs hold fairly steady near 33°C through the month.

A typical December day in Pindaré-Mirim reaches about 33°C in the afternoon and slips back to 25°C overnight — a 9°C spread between the day's warmth and the night's chill. On most days the high lands between 31°C and 35°C. Set against its neighbours, December runs about 1°C cooler than November and about 2°C warmer than January.

Cloud cover in December

ClearMostly clearPartly cloudyMostly cloudyOvercast

The sky is clear or mostly clear about 17% of the time in December.

Beyond those clear spells, partly cloudy skies cover about 20% of December, with mostly cloudy or overcast conditions the remaining 63%. Skies tend to cloud over as the month goes on.

Chance of precipitation in December

Any precipitation

Pindaré-Mirim gets around 108 mm of rain over 14.6 wet days in December. The line is the day-by-day chance of measurable precipitation.

Day to day, the chance of measurable rain averages around 47% and peaks near 68% on the wettest days. The odds climb toward the end of the month.

Humidity in December

DryComfortableHumidMuggyOppressiveMiserable

Most of December feels oppressive — the stacked bands show each day's mix of comfort levels, read off the dew point.

By dew point, December lands in the oppressive band about 75% of days. Sticky, muggy-or-worse air turns up on roughly 100% of them.

UV index in Pindaré-Mirim in December

LowModerateHighVery highExtreme

Clear-sky midday UV in December peaks around 11 (very high — sun protection essential). The full-year curve, shaded by WHO exposure level, is below.

Under clear skies, the midday UV index in Pindaré-Mirim peaks around March 17 at about 15 (extreme) — sunscreen, a hat and midday shade are essential. It bottoms out near July 17 at about 10 (extreme).

The index reaches 3 or more — the level where the WHO recommends sun protection — every month of the year.

Air quality in Pindaré-Mirim in December

GoodModeratePoorUnhealthyVery unhealthy

Average fine-particle pollution (PM2.5) through the year — so you can see where December falls, not just the annual average.

Air quality in Pindaré-Mirim is worst in November — around 22 µg/m³ PM2.5 (moderate), about 2.6× the cleanest month (July, 8 µg/m³).

Modeled monthly averages (CAMS reanalysis, 2015–2024).

Location & terrain

Where is Pindaré-Mirim?

Pindaré-Mirim sits at 3.6°S, 45.3°W, 24 m above sea level, in Brazil. The nearest listed city is Santa Inês, 8.0 km away.

Topography around Pindaré-Mirim

How much the land rises and falls, and what covers it, within 3, 16 and 80 km of Pindaré-Mirim.

Within 3 km, the terrain around Pindaré-Mirim has only modest variations in elevation — a maximum elevation change of 30 m around an average of 13 m above sea level; within 16 km, only modest variations in elevation — a maximum elevation change of 52 m; within 80 km, only modest variations in elevation — a maximum elevation change of 223 m.

The land around Pindaré-Mirim is covered by grassland (65%) within 3 km, grassland (50%) and trees (33%) within 16 km, and grassland (59%) and trees (34%) within 80 km.
